Abstract

The generation of an array of dark solitons stripes in the spatial domain is now a field of research. Theoretically, it can be shown that a transverse field distribution evolves into a periodic array of clean and stable dark soliton stripes. This paper outlines the numerical and experimental studies in this field as well as the results obtained to date.
